Output 339834a631b2759ff32fc044deffc540405fbd86945aae537a62c648f26ad0bc:25

value
2981354
script pubkey
OP_0 OP_PUSHBYTES_20 7d12fd42a70d0e674b53dcadb3915c05df2cf1bf
address
ltc1q05f06s48p58xwj6nmjkm8y2uqh0jeudlyu8ws0
transaction
339834a631b2759ff32fc044deffc540405fbd86945aae537a62c648f26ad0bc
spent
true